Output efec34e72280b047a2e3ac8afcd126004f1fb5f3b752eab5f21461acbb6fdefd:0

value
23879864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e65fa08edf486ff2f8f278956a9a80f6a9a7bc3 OP_EQUAL
address
MLt6M8oakyLr22SXiLdR8TRA5M2bvcqxZE
transaction
efec34e72280b047a2e3ac8afcd126004f1fb5f3b752eab5f21461acbb6fdefd
spent
true